King Mswati accused of endorsing SA political party

Date: Aug 19, 2024

The Swaziland Solidarity Network has accused King Mswati of eSwatini of endorsing South Africa's (SA) uMkhonto we Sizwe, MK party.

This after the daughter of the former President Jacob Zuma, who is the leader of the MK party, Nomcebo Zuma was seen wearing an uMkhonto We Sizwe regalia while bidding farewell to the king.

The movement says it is a criminal offence to be seen wearing any political regalia as political parties are banned in the country.

Zuma's daughter is engaged to the King and is reportedly facing hostility since the engagement was announced. Movement Spokesperson, Lucky Lukhele says they suspect that there is a lot of money laundering that is happening between the former President and the king, “It is an open secret that some of the money of the late Muammar Gaddafi the President of Libya was hidden in Swaziland and these two leaders know the truth.

If you can go now and go to the home affairs and look at Zuma's passport how many times does he stamp into Swaziland per month you would be shocked. I'm sure Zuma is changing passport every second month.

But most of the pages are owned into Swaziland, that tells you that there is a systematic pimping of these girls but at the same time cleaning money that we don't know where they got".
